Christmas Carol," the Ghost of Christmas Present is described as a jovial giant clad in a green mantle trimmed with white fur, with an icicle studded wreath of holly upon his head. He carries a torch shaped like a horn, from which the Spirit spreads his blessing of hope and good cheer.
As with any hand-finished product, ornament received will be similar but unique.